Some of the stuff Perez said was true, but his conclusions are wrong.
He is correct that not many watch the Champions League until the later stages, but that is probably because it is all so predictable. It was designed to keep the big clubs in it. There is little chance of a lesser club winning it.
Also, young fans have been disenfranchised by the cost of football in general and Playstations are far more entertaining for the price.
Players wages have sickened us all. They are quite frankly an abomination and put a wedge between clubs and fans.

I think we have probably reached the peak of football revenue and football needs to plan for less.

To secure itself, something has to be done about player wages and agent fees.

Ticket prices have to fall.

The leagues need to be more competitive, so we are not stuck with the same clubs winning year after year.

The closed shop arrangements have to end. They damage the integrity of the competitions.

Okay how about this for a complete revamp.

Each season is split into mini-seasons. Domestic, European and International Season. This way we have a break in between every season of about a week or two.

Domestic: August - April
European: May
International: June-July

The European stuff would be based on the season just completed, so it truly is incorporating the form of the team (i.e not an instance like Wolves who have a great season, but then have a sloppy season and Europe just makes it all worse).

Pros? The excitement of competitions don't have a break. How good would it be to not have international breaks etc, and how good would it be to see a Champions League etc completed over the course of a month as opposed to the full season. This also means that we don't have players getting injured mid season due to internationals etc...

Can't really see many cons to be honest.

No. There is 4 extra slots for the whole of europe.

2 of which are for clubs that fall outside of automatic qualifying positions. So they could be in the Europa league for instance.

‘Awarded to the two clubs with the highest club coefficients that have not qualified automatically for the Champions League’s league stage, but have qualified either for the Champions League qualification phase or the Europa League/the Europa Conference League (due to start in the 2021/22 season).’

it’s designed purely for when one of the 12 have bad seasons a la Liverpool, Spurs and arsenal this season.
